Web6 feb. 2024 · For most problems, you'll deal with hydrogen so you can use the formula: 1/λ = RH(1/n12- 1/n22) where RHis Rydberg's constant, since the Z of hydrogen is 1. Rydberg Formula Worked Example Problem Find the wavelength of the electromagnetic radiationthat is emitted from an electron that relaxes from n = 3 to n = 1.
